Cranston man pleads guilty to drug trafficking charges

PROVIDENCE, R.I. (WLNE) — A Cranston man pled guilty in court on Monday to charges relating to the trafficking of tens-of-thousands of methamphetamine-laced pills, according to Acting United States Attorney Sara Miron Bloom.

37-year-old Anthony Stevens, of Cranston, pled guilty to two counts of possession with intent to distribute 500 grams or more of methamphetamine.
